Description
Battlefields: Dear Billy Comics Lot w/ Variant
Writer: Garth Ennis
Artist: Peter Snejbjerg
Colorist: Rob Steen
Letterer: Simon Bowland
Cover #1 by: John Cassaday
Cover #2 by: John Cassaday
Cover #3 by: John Cassaday
Variant Cover #1C by: Garry Leach
“Dear Billy” is the devastating story of the emotional wounds of Carrie Sutton, an English girl whose longing to see the Orient led to her taking a job as a nurse in Singapore. The young British Nurse is serving in the South China Sea in World War II when the base is captured by Japanese soldiers. Fleeing Singapore following General Percival’s surrender to the Japanese invasion force, she and her fellow nurses are intercepted, gang-raped, and then machine-gunned and left for dead in the waters. The sole survivor, Carrie is rescued by a passing RAF flying boat, and ends up working at a hospital in Calcutta, keeping the details of her rape a secret from everyone else. She enters into a romantic relationship with the titular Billy, a British pilot who ends up in the hospital before rejoining the front. But when Japanese POWs begin arriving at the hospital for treatment, Carrie embarks on a bloody course of revenge.
Her perspective on the war is brutal and unapologetic, but also beautifully written in the form of a love letter to her lover, Billy.
